חבילות Deb בלינוקס הן סוג של אלטרנטיבה לפורמט.msi ב- Windows. קובץ ה-.deb הוא ארכיב לחילוץ עצמי של תוכנית. הופעתו של פורמט קובץ זה הקלה מאוד על התקנת האפליקציות, שבוצעה בעבר על ידי בנייה ממקור, שלעתים הייתה די קשה הן למשתמשי לינוקס למתחילים והן למתקדמים.
נחוץ
ארכיב עם קוד המקור של היישום הנדרש
הוראות
שלב 1
ראשית, בדקו אם התוכנית הנחוצה לכם היא בפורמט.deb באינטרנט. ליישומים פופולריים רבים יש מתקין אוטומטי במשך זמן רב. אם אין חבילת deb עבור המערכת שלך, תוכל להוריד בבטחה את מקורות השירות הדרוש.
שלב 2
וודא שהתקנת את כל התוכניות שאתה צריך לבנות. לשם כך, במסוף (תפריט - תוכניות - אביזרים - טרמינל) הזן את הפקודה הבאה: sudo apt-get install libtool autotools-dev dpkg-buildpackage fakeroot אתה יכול גם להתקין ספריות אלה ממנהל החבילות Synaptic באובונטו.
שלב 3
הכן ספריית עבודה בה תבצע את כל הפעולות. צור תיקיה נוחה עבורך ופתח את התוכנה שהורדת לתוכה.
שלב 4
פתח את הטרמינל ונווט לספרייה המתאימה. לדוגמא: cd / src / my_program / program_123 תוכנית_123 היא הספרייה בה נמצאים כל קבצי היישומים.
שלב 5
בצע את הבנייה הראשונית:./ configure && make Next, עליך "לבצע שינויים בביצוע". באותה ספריה, הפעל את הפקודה: dh_make
שלב 6
לאחר מכן, יהיה עליך לבחור את סוג החבילה. הנפוץ ביותר הוא "בינארי יחיד". כדי לבחור אותו, פשוט הזן את האות "s".
שלב 7
פתח את ספריית "דביאן" שנוצרה וערוך את קובץ ה"בקרה ". הזן תיאור לתוכנית. אלה המילים שהמשתמש יראה כאשר יסתכל על תוכן החבילה ב- Synaptic.
שלב 8
פתוח דביאן / כללים. בטל את ההערה של השורה "dh_install" על ידי הסרת "#" בהתחלה.
שלב 9
במסוף הזן: dpkg-buildpackage –rfakeroot ונווט לספריה ברמה אחת למעלה והצג את תוכנה: cd.. && ls
שלב 10
בין שאר הקבצים תראה את חבילת הדיב שנוצרה לאחרונה. ניתן להתקין על ידי לחיצה כפולה על הקובץ.